Thanked 0 Times in 0 PostsI don't have xp, otherwise i'd be happy to help.
It wouldn't hurt to try this:
1. Remove the M8 device driver from device manager via uninstal.
2. Disconnect M8 from computer.
3.Uninstall activesync from your computer.
4. Restart.
5. Install Activesync from M8 CD(Donot Connect M8)
6. Restart computer (leave the M8 CD in the computer)
PrtScn20090403222441.jpg
7. On M8 select USB mode to activesync (as in picture)
8. Connect M8 to the computer see what happens.
If nothing happens then try the two steps i mentioned in my first post again.
If this does not work, then i am sorry, i am at the limit of my understanding... any other whizes out there feel free to edit my mistakes in this procedure, but without entering the registery or anything this seems like the only viable procedure.
